Description: Includes descriptive metadata provided by producer in MP3 file: "A new Vanderbilt undergraduate class blends politics and genetics to study the impact of genetic make-up on an individual's political behavior. The spring 2008 course will be taught by Distinguished Professor of Political Science John Geer and David Bader, a professor of cell and development biology and professor of medicine. Bader is also the Gladys Parkinson Stahlman Professor of Cardiovascular Research." Ann Marie Deer Owens interviews Geer and Bader.
